The Flag of St. Kitts & Nevis

Welcome to our interactive timeline, where you can explore the key moments in the history of the St Kitts and Nevis flag. Scroll through to discover the story behind the flag, from its colonial past to its role in the present day.

  • Pre-1967: Flags used during the colonial period, representing British rule over the islands.
  • 1967: The adoption of the West Indies Associated States flag as St. Kitts and Nevis gained internal self-government.
  • 1983: Introduction of the national flag designed by Edris Lewis, coinciding with independence on September 19, 1983.
  • 1983-Present: The flag’s role in national celebrations, its display at international events, and its enduring significance as a symbol of unity and independence.
